MyEasyFarm, the leading AgTech startup in precision farming low-carbon agriculture, announces a partnership with the cooperatives of La Tricherie and Mansle on the Vivasol project, one of the winning projects of Solnovo.
Solnovo is a multi-stakeholder action-research program that aims to support the transition to Regenerative Agriculture and to demonstrate its benefits at the national and European levels. It is a program initiated and led by the Agri Sud-Ouest Innovation. The cluster brings together nearly 420 private and public organizations active in the agriculture, agri-food, and agro-resources sectors, of which MyEasyFarm is a member.
Vivasol aims to structure collective approaches to Regenerative Agriculture and is in the financing phase on the Miimosa platform.
Located in the Nouvelle-Aquitaine region, these 2 cooperatives, based in Vienne (86) and Charente (16), have set themselves the goal, via Miimosa's participative financing, of enabling the implementation of various ambitious agricultural practices. Vivasol is a field crop project involving 21 farmers in the Nouvelle-Aquitaine region, with a total committed surface area of around 4,400 ha.
Farmers' objectives are focused on changing farming practices: integration of plant cover, integration of more legumes, reduced tillage, introduction of hedges and grass strips, etc.
